The Steering Committee for the Delta Disciples Mission Trip has been planning logistics, recruiting volunteers and soliciting potential projects. The trip is scheduled for March 24-27. The annual Empty Bowls event held in the Spiritan Center which benefits Bethlehem House was moved from a February date to April 20. A professional Bethlehem House video will also be screened with the meal. The “Lettuce Grow” Family Mission Trip to the St. Joseph Center in North Little Rock is being planned. A date sometime after Spring Break but before the middle of June is being contemplated. The Hand-in-Hand Ministries’ “Building for Change” trip to Belize is set for May 1-7. Ten volunteers are registered and partially paid. A planning meeting led by Hand-inHand is set for April 5. A $5,000 parish subsidy payment is being sought. A question was asked about an event tentatively scheduled for a Friday evening in May called “Poverty Simulation.” It’s a threehour program in which participants get a sense of what living in poverty can be like. It’s been described as a “moving experience.”
